    Step-by-Step Installation Guide

    Windows Installation

    To install the Bald Eagle Font on Windows:

    1. Download the font files
    2. Extract the files to a folder
    3. Right-click on the font file and select “Install”

    Mac Installation

    To install the Bald Eagle Font on Mac:

    1. Download the font files
    2. Extract the files to a folder
    3. Open the Font Book application and drag the font file into the window

    Linux Installation

    To install the Bald Eagle Font on Linux:

    1. Download the font files
    2. Extract the files to a folder
    3. Copy the font files to the ~/.local/share/fonts directory

    Web Use with @font-face

    To use the Bald Eagle Font on the web:

    
    @font-face {
        font-family: 'Bald Eagle Font';
        src: url('bald-eagle-font.woff2') format('woff2'),
             url('bald-eagle-font.woff') format('woff');
        font-weight: normal;
        font-style: normal;
        font-display: swap;
    }
    

    CSS Implementation for Websites

    To implement the Bald Eagle Font on your website:

    • Upload the font files to your server
    • Use the @font-face rule to define the font
    • Apply the font to your HTML elements using CSS

    Here’s an example:

    
    body {
        font-family: 'Bald Eagle Font', sans-serif;
        font-size: 18px;
    }
    

    Performance Optimization Tips

    To optimize the performance of the Bald Eagle Font:

    • Subset the font to only include the characters you need
    • Preload the font using the tag
    • Use the font-display property to control font rendering
    • Cache the font files using a caching plugin or service

    What is the difference between OTF and TTF for Bald Eagle Font?

    The OTF (OpenType) and TTF (TrueType) formats are both widely used font formats. The main difference is that OTF supports more advanced typographic features, such as ligatures and stylistic alternates.
